How to fill out pro forma memorandum of

Illustration
01
Start by gathering all the necessary information: Before filling out the pro forma memorandum of, make sure you have all the relevant details at hand. This includes the names and contact information of all parties involved, the purpose of the memorandum, and any other specific information that needs to be included.
02
Begin with the heading: Start by entering the title "Pro Forma Memorandum of" or any other appropriate heading at the top of the document. This will make it clear what the memorandum is for and help establish its purpose.
03
Include the date and place of the memorandum: On the top right or left corner, indicate the date and place where the memorandum is being prepared. This helps provide context and ensures that the document is properly dated for future reference.
04
State the parties involved: Clearly identify the parties involved in the memorandum. This usually includes the names, titles, and contact information of both the initiating party and the receiving party. It is important to accurately represent this information to avoid any confusion or misunderstanding.
05
Define the purpose and scope: Provide a brief but clear statement about the purpose and scope of the memorandum. This section should explain why this document is being created and what it aims to achieve. It helps to be concise and specific to avoid any ambiguity.
06
Present the terms and conditions: Lay out the terms and conditions that both parties have agreed upon. This section may include clauses related to confidentiality, non-disclosure, intellectual property, or any other relevant agreements. It is crucial to ensure that the terms are fair, transparent, and mutually beneficial for both parties.
07
Include any necessary attachments or exhibits: If there are any additional documents or exhibits that need to accompany the memorandum, make sure to attach them appropriately. This may include specific agreements, financial statements, or supporting materials that provide further context or information.
08
Review and proofread: Before finalizing the memorandum, take the time to review and proofread it thoroughly. Make sure that all the information is accurate, the format is consistent, and there are no spelling or grammatical errors. This step is crucial to maintain professionalism and ensure the overall clarity of the document.

Who needs a pro forma memorandum of?

01
Business professionals: Pro forma memorandums are commonly used in the business world to outline agreements, partnerships, or important terms between different organizations or parties. Entrepreneurs, managers, executives, and business owners often utilize these documents to ensure clear communication and protect their interests.
02
Legal professionals: Lawyers and legal practitioners may require pro forma memorandums as part of their legal contract drafting process. These documents serve as a valuable framework for defining legal obligations, rights, and responsibilities between parties and can provide clarity in case of any disputes or issues that may arise.
03
Government agencies: Some government agencies may request or require the submission of pro forma memorandums for various purposes. This could include applications for grants or funding, partnerships with other entities, or compliance with specific regulations or policies.
04
Non-profit organizations: Non-profit organizations often use pro forma memorandums when collaborating with other organizations or stakeholders. These documents can help establish the terms of engagement, secure funding or sponsorship, or outline shared objectives and responsibilities.
05
Individuals involved in legal or financial transactions: Individuals who are engaging in significant legal or financial transactions, such as buying or selling property or businesses, may also require pro forma memorandums. These documents can protect their interests, outline important terms and conditions, and provide a legal framework for the transaction.
